Trying to figure out how old my Whirlpool washer is?

Trying to figure out how old my Whirlpool washer is Locate your machine's nameplate, which contains both the model and serial numbers. On top-loading Whirlpool washing machines, open the lid and look for the tag at the top rear of the tub. On front-loading washers, the tag is usually inside the door or near the bottom of the left or right side of the cabinet. If the tag is not in one of those places, pull the machine away from the wall and check the rear. Record the serial number with a pencil and paper or take a photograph. Be sure to record the serial number, not the model number. Decode the serial number at an online source like Appliance Cafe or Appliance 411 (links in Resources). Whirlpool serial numbers include a code in the second character for the year the product was built. Before 1990, the character was a number; from 1990 to 2010 the character was a letter. The number sequence started over in 2011.

How to recalibrate Golf Buddy Voice 2

Please perform a firmware update on your unit through using GB manager. If that does not fix the issue, attempt the following steps to perform an emergency reboot: *NOTE: If you have a WORLD unit, please replace the MENU button with the PROPLAY button to perform this reboot. 1. Please make sure that the unit is turned OFF. 2. Hold down the MENU button, then press the POWER button simultaneously. 3. Once the LCD (screen) powers on, release the POWER button BUT keep the MENU button pressed. 4. Once you see EMERGENCY REBOOT on the screen, release the MENU button and wait about 3-5 minutes for reboot to factory settings. You may also try the emergency reboot using your computer (most effective way) by following these steps: 1. Make sure the GolfBuddy is powered off. 2. Please connect your USB cable to the computer WITHOUT your unit. 3. Hold down the Menu button. 4. As you are holding the Menu button down, please connect your GolfBuddy to the USB cable. 5. Once you see the EMERGENCY REBOOT screen, please release the Menu button but leave your unit connected to the USB cable until the process completes.

How do i replace the hand grip on guardian red dot crutches?

I had the same problem, but i found an answer.have a friend with 2 good feet help you with this. Turn the crutch upside down and place armrest on the ground.Stand on the outside edges of the armrest and pull crutch upward. The armrest is not glued to the rest of the unit. It's just a snug fit. Once the armrest is removed, the hand piece can be removed. Now comes the struggle to remove the damaged rubber hand grip, and put the new one on, took me about 5 minutes to do this step.Then reverse what you've done, put the hand grip back on the crutch, put the armrest back on, turn the crutch upside down, and push the armrest back into place.Hope this helps!

300 savage model 99. What year was it mfg. ?

You did not supply all needed information so I am just guessing this might help. Dates of Manufacture* for: Savage 1895/1899/99. . Our database contains values of serial numbers through 566,000 which ended the year 1950. Serials did not strictly run sequentially. Therefore, dates may be a year different, especially near the "boundaries". Enter the serial number (leave out the "," or ".") of your Savage 1895/1899/99 in the box below: American Rifleman (July, 1980; page 28) contains a very different set of dates for serial numbers through 193000. Enter the serial number (leave out the "," or ".") of your Savage 1895/1899 in the box below: Lever Boss Codes: A = 1949 B = 1950 C = 1951 D = 1952 E = 1953 F = 1954 G = 1955 H = 1956 I = 1957 J = 1958 K = 1959 L = 1960 M = 1961 N = 1962 P = 1963 R = 1964 S = 1965 T = 1966 U = 1967 V = 1968 W = 1969 X = 1970
